Perfect state transfer on distance-regular graphs and association schemes

Abstract

We consider the representation of a continuous-time quantum walk in a graph XX by the matrix exp(itA(X))\exp(itA(X)). We provide necessary and sufficient criteria for distance-regular graphs and, more generally, for graphs in association schemes to have perfect state transfer. Using these conditions, we provide several new examples of perfect state transfer in simple graphs.
